[0030] image 3 The sound chamber structure of a smoke alarm of the present invention has a side sectional view of three pins, please combine image 3 As shown, a sound cavity structure of a preferred smoke alarm is shown, including a casing 1, a bottom plate 2 and a front cover shell 3, the bottom plate 2 is arranged at one end of the casing 1, and the front cover shell 3 It is arranged at the other end of the housing 1 , and the front cover 3 is provided with a sound emitting hole 32 .
